Hardie, of Teutonic origin, derives from the Old German word meaning 'bold', 'daring', or 'hardy'. It evokes qualities of courage, resilience, and strength, often associated with warriors or leaders. The name carries a rugged, enduring appeal, reflecting a steadfast and determined character.
